Hi Fujiwara-san,
TUSB321AI in DFP mode would not connected with Type-C-A conversion cable. These type-s of cable typically have embedded Rp termination and have a male Type-A connector to connect to a USB Host or DFP. DFP to DFP connection is not allowed in USB or USB-C. For this type of connection

Hi Fujiwara-san,
Correct, if TUSB321AI is in DRP mode then TUSB321AI will detect a Type-C-A conversion cable.

Hi Fujiwara-san,
If this cable implements a Rd on the CC pins then the current level will be set by the CURRENT_MODE pin.
